The Strategy: Mapping Your Route and Inventory

The first rule of a multi-stop move is that inventory is not treated as one giant pile. Categorizing belonging based on their final destination is a must.
Segment Inventory: Create a master list divided by Stop. For example

  • Stop 1 Storage: Winter clothes, extra books, gym equipment.
  • Stop 2 New Apartment: Bedding, kitchen essentials, work from home setup
  • Logical Routing: Working with the moving team to determine the most fuel-efficient and time-effective path. It usually makes sense to visit the drop-off points, like a charity center or storage. Before heading to the final residence, clear space in the truck.

The Art of Loading: Last in, First Out (LIFO)

Standard move, the heaviest items go in first, but in multi-stop on move, the destination dictates the order.
The LIFO Method: Belongings intended for the last stop should be loaded into the front of the truck. Belongings for the first stop must be loaded last, just right by the back doors.

Visual Dividers

AuSafe Removals recommends using colored tape or a large, bold marker to distinguish stops. For instance, use Red Tape for items going to storage and Green Tape for items going to the new home. This prevents the movers from accidentally unloading the wrong box at the wrong location.

Coordination, Access, and Timing

Multi stop move is a race against the clock, so any first stop delays will ripple through the entire day.
Secure Permissions: If one stops is apartment complex or a storage facility, then ensure that the elevator is reserved and confirm the gate codes in advance.
Factor in Traffic: Moving across Brisbane or Interstate, then remember that a fully loaded moving truck moves more slowly than a car.

Communication is Key

Having clear communication before the truck even arrives is vital.
The Pre Move Briefing: Booking with AuSafe Removals clearly states the number of stops. And provide customized quotes based on the complexity of the route.
On-Site Liaison: Ideally, having one person stationed at each Stop to greet the movers and direct traffic. Managing the move alone,e then we need to stay in constant contact with the lead movers to confirm which items stay and which ones go at each location.

Protecting Your Assets

Because items will be shifted and potentially rearranged during the intermediatestop o,ps that’s wprofessional-gradeade packing is non-negotiable
Heavy Duty Materials: Use double-walled boxes for items that will be handled multiple times.
Padding and Strapping: Ensure that after each stop, the remaining load is resecured. A partially empty truck allows for more movement during transit, increasing the risk of damage. AuSafe Removals’ teams use high-quality blankets and straps to keep Stop 2 items safe while Stop 1 is being unloaded.

Does AuSafe Removals charge extra for additional stops?

Yes. There is a small additional fee per stop to account for the extra time, fuel, and labour involved in navigation and resecuring the load.

Can I add a stop to my move on the day of the relocation?

While AuSafe Removals strives to be flexible. It’s highly recommended to book stops in advance. This ensures the allocation of the correct truck size and crew for your specific timeline.

How should I label boxes for a multi-stop move?

Use a Stop Number system. Clearly write which STOP 1: STORAGE or STOP 2: NEW HOUSE on at least three sides of every box.

Is my furniture insured during the extra stop?

Absolutely. AuSafe Removals transit insurance covers belongings from the moment they are picked up until the final item is placed in its destination.

What if one stop has difficult access, like a narrow lane or high rise?

Please informing at AuSafe Removals during the quoting process. Because utilizing specialized equipment like trolleys or a smaller FERRY vehicle to move items from the main truck to a hard-to-reach location is important.

Why Proper Packing Matters for Musical Instruments?

Musical instruments are very sensitive. they can be easily damaged by an accidental drop, temperature fluctuations, humidity and rough handling. They are not like household objects and improper packing of any kind of musical instrument can cause :

  1. Crack in wooden bodies
  2. Bent keys or strings
  3. Internal electronic or mechanical damage
  4. Warped surface and ruined sound quality

So, from here you can see why careful packing is important to keep your instrument safe while shifting and hence proper packing helps protect your instrument and ensures it reach its destination safely.

Things You Need Before You Start Packing

As we all know that musical instruments are very expensive and valuable so before packing we should have the right packing materials to ensure the safety of the product. Professional movers like ausafe Removals always use high-grade packing materials and tools to guarantee safe transport. wheather you are covering a short or a long distance.

Packing Materials You Need

  • Protective case (premium over soft cases)
  • bubble pack and proper foam padding
  • Packing papers or soft cloths
  • Sturdy moving boxes
  • Packing tape and labels that show “heavy” or “light”
  • you can use Silica gel packets for moisture control

Choosing the Right Protection Cases

You should always use a hard and strong case to pack your musical instruments. Hard cases give better protection from bumps, pressure and accidental drops during the move. Soft instrumental bags do not provide proper safety to the instrument, so they should only be used as extra padding inside and for outside hard boxes should be used.

Tips for Packing Your Instruments Without Damage

Different types of instruments need different packing methods. Let’s see how to pack each one of them safely :

  • String instruments like (Guitars, Violins, Cellos)
  • String instruments are valuable and can break easily.

Packing Step-by-Step

  1. Loose the guitars , violins or cellos strings to decrease the tension.
  2. Wrap the instrument in soft cloth or packing paper.
  3. Use foam or padding inside the instrument case.
  4. Wrap the hard case with bubble wrap for extra protection.
  5. Place in a sturdy cardboard box with cushioning on all sides.

Pro Tip : For old or wooden instruments, use breathable material and always avoid plastic directly against the wood.

Keyboards, Digital Pianos & Electric Instruments

Modern electronic instruments need certified packing to avoid circuit damage. Some Safe Packing Tips are:

  • Remove the parts which are possible to remove (pedals, stands, cables).
  • Wrap the controls in bubble wrap to provide them proper safety.
  • Put the instrument in a hard (protective) box with foam inside.
  • Keep the instrument in standing upright position to secure it.

Acoustic Pianos & Grand Pianos

Understanding the Risks Books Face During Moving

Before you start packing your books into boxes, let’s talk about what can go wrong with your books. While shifting pages can get bent or torn accidentally. Book covers can also get crushed. Water can ruin your whole book. Sometimes boxes break because books are too heavy. Hot weather can make books warp and wetness can also cause mold. And when you know all these problems you can avoid them.

Planning Your Move:-

Sort Your Books First :- before you pack anything, first look at all your books and ask yourself (do i really want to keep these books ?) because sometimes especially as a book lover you always have a huge collection of books in which there are many books which you have read already and now you don’t need them and when we you will do this you will realize that there are a lot of books you actually don’t need and you can donate all these old books to libraries. You can also sell books you don’t need and hence this makes moving easier and cheaper because you have fewer boxes to carry.

Make a List of Your Books:- if you have many books make a list of them. Take photos of your bookshelves with you smart phone. Write down the names of expensive or special books (like gifted books). This helps you know if any book is missing. It also helps if somethings gets damaged and you need to make an insurance claim.

Get the Right Packing Materials :- Use Small Boxes:- Here’s a big mistake people make. They use big boxes for books instead of using small boxes. Books are generally very heavy. A big box full of books can weigh too much to lift. It can also break open. That is why you should always use small boxes and the best boxes are about the size of a shoebox or a little bigger. Make sure the boxes are strong and have good bottoms. Remember the boxes should be able to manage the weight of the boxes and protect the books from accidental drops.

Other Things You Need :- don’t use newspapers to wrap your books. Instead of newspaper use the white packing paper because newspapers can make books dirty, use bubble wrap for special books, plastic bags in case it rains, strong tape and markers or labels to write on boxes. Don’t use cheap tape because it comes off easily.

How to Pack Books the Right Way?

Packing Regular Books

First, put some crumpled paper at the bottom of each box. This protects your books. Divide all the boxes into sections and then place them into the box or stand them up with the spine facing down position. Never stand books on their edges because this hurts the blinding. Put books in different directions in each layer, just like building with blocks. This uses space better and keeps weight even.

Fill empty spaces with paper so that the books don’t move around. Here’s an important rule: if you can’t lift the box easily (it’s too heavy). Take some books out. A box should weigh about 30 pounds or less (generally).

Packing Special or Old Books :- As a book lover you may have a huge book collection. In which there are a lot of expensive and special books. For book lovers books have a emotional importance. And this becomes very important to wrap each book carefully in a bubble wrap or special paper which is able to protect the book from scratches. For specially for special books you should carry them in your car instead of putting them in the moving truck while relocating. This keeps them extra safe.

Packing Big Books:- Big art books and coffee table books need special care. So always lay them flat, put them in a standing position in the box. Use bigger boxes with strong bottoms. Don’t put too many heavy books together because they can break their own covers from the weight and always divide books into different sections.

Label Your Boxes

Write clearly on every box. Tell what’s inside, which room it goes to, and write “HEAVY” or “FRAGILE” this is very important to mark so that the person who is going to pick the box get to know that the item inside is heavy. Also number each box and write down what’s inside. You can also use different colored tape for different rooms. This makes unpacking much easier and stress free. And when you’re tired and surrounded by boxes in your new home, you’ll be happy you did this.

Moving Your Books

Loading the Truck :- Put book boxes on the bottom of the moving truck. Books are heavy and will crush other things if you put them on top. Make sure you pack boxes close together so that they don’t slide around. Don’t put breakable things on top of books boxes.

Protecting Books from Weather:- Don’t leave books in a hot truck or storage room for a long time. As I have mentioned in the second paragraph, heat can warp books and make covers crack. Wetness causes mold and makes pages wavy in short heat destroys the book. So if you are relocating in summers and covering long distances pay extra for a moving truck which has air conditioning. This protects your books from weather damage.

Unpacking Your Books

Take you time when unpacking. Look at each book to see if it got damaged. This is important if you need to tell your insurance company about problems. Unpacking all the books slowly also lets you organize your books better than before and now you will have extra space for new books because you have donated or sold the old books you don’t want anymore.

1. Back Injuries

How they happen?

When it comes to the moving process, Back injuries are the most common issue. If you lift boxes incorrectly or try to move large furniture without help, then this ignorance can strain or tear muscles in your lower back. It’s also important to know that if you bend at the waist repeatedly while packing or unpacking, this can cause pain and fatigue over time.

How to Avoid Them?
By having a good posture, keep your back straight, bend your knees and use your legs to lift.

  • Avoid twisting your torso while carrying items.
  • If you lift heavy boxes,this can cause you back injury, so try to lift boxes under 20-25 kg for easy lifting.
  • There are so many tools that use them. Like trolleys, straps, and sliders for heavy furniture.
  • Two people are better than one; two people can move an item more safely than one.

If you have some heavy, large and bulky furniture, then let Aussafe Removals take care of it. Our team is trained to handle this kind of heavy lifting safely and efficiently.

2. Shoulder and Neck Strain

How they happen
If there is anything which you carry above shoulder level, it puts stress on your neck and shoulder muscles, and this poor posture, sudden movement, or carrying uneven loads can make your shoulder and neck condition worse.

How to Avoid Them?

  • Don’t lift heavy items above waist level
  • Stretch and warm up your body before starting your move.
  • Take frequent breaks to avoid overuse injuries.

Any ignorance costs you your health and money. So, with the help of professional movers like Ausafe Removals.

3. Knee Injuries

How they happen?
Whenever you lift heavy weights, especially from the ground, climbing stairs with heavy boxes can put too much pressure on your knees, which increases the chances of heavy injuries.

How to Avoid Them?

  • Bend your knees and keep your shoulder width apart while lifting.
  • Don’t carry heavy boxes upstairs alone and ask someone for help.
  • Wear supportive shoes with good grip and cushioning.

4. Cuts, Bruises, and Scrapes

How they happen?
While moving, there are many sharp edges on furniture, broken glass, or tools that can cut and scrape during packing or loading.

How to Avoid Them?

  • Always wear protective gloves to handle boxes and furniture.
  • Carefully wrap fragile items securely in bubble wrap or paper.
  • Use corner protectors on sharp-edged furniture.

5. Foot and toe Injuries

How they happen?
Lifting any heavy boxes or furniture can cause a serious problem to your feet & toes if they drop on your feet and toes. So, if you are walking barefoot or wearing open-toed shoes while moving, this risk is even higher.

How to Avoid Them?

  • Wearing closed-toe shoes with sturdy soles helps you to protect your feet.
  • Avoid stacking boxes too high so that they cannot fall unexpectedly.

6. Slips, Trips, and Falls

How they happen?
In the process of moving, there is navigating stairs, ramps, and cluttered spaces. Wet floors, loose cables or scattered packing materials that can easily cause slips or trips

How to Avoid Them?

  • You have to keep hallways and doorways clear at all times.
  • To avoid slipping, use non-slip mats or rugs on smooth floors.
  • Wear shoes with good traction.

Detailed Steps on How to Create a Moving Timeline?

Create a Moving Timeline

Creating a moving timeline directly involves planning your move week by week so that nothing is missed. Let’s see by step-by-step guide on how to create a moving timeline:

Step 1: Decide Moving Date

First of all, your moving date is the main anchor of your entire timeline. For that, you can consider the following things, such as

  • Lease or property possession date
  • School or work schedule
  • Availability of Moving Company

Step 2: Set a Moving Budget

Now, set a moving budget, like determining how much you want to spend on moving house. Some of its considerations:

  • Professional movers or truck rentals
  • Storage Solution (If needed)
  • Packing Supplies
  • Cleaning Services
  • Travel or Temporary Accommodations

Step 3: Create a Master Moving Checklist

Now, make a master moving checklist in which all the moving-related tasks should be listed. It includes:

  • Storing or decluttering belongings
  • Packing items room by room
  • Arranging internet setup
  • Updating address with banks and others
  • Hiring a moving company or arranging transport

Step 4: Declutter & Organize Properly

Now start organizing your belongings properly, like:

  • Donate, sell or discard unused items
  • Identify items of storage
  • Group items by category or room name

Step 5: Gather Packing Supplies

Now, start collecting everything that you need for packing, like:

  • Various-sized boxes
  • Packing tape and label
  • Bubble wrap or packing paper
  • Marker pens for labelling

Step 6: Divide Tasks Week by Week

Now start dividing tasks week by week. Let’s see:

8-6 Weeks Before Moving

This week, you just finalized the moving date, budget, researched moving companies, started decluttering, and started packing non-essential items.

5-4 Weeks Before Moving

In this, you do:

  • Confirm the moving company booking
  • Continue Packing
  • Arrange Storage, if needed
  • Notify Your Landlord

3-2 Weeks Before Moving
This week, you should plan:

  • Notify utility providers
  • Schedule Transfer
  • Update address with banks, subscription and insurance
  • Prepare Inventory for all Items
  • Pack Special Items

1 Week Before Moving
Before 1 week of the move, you should plan:

  • Pack Essentials separately
  • Clean your current home
  • Disassemble furniture
  • Confirm moving day logistics

Moving Day
On moving day, you should focus on:

  • Supervise loading and transport
  • Keep important documents with you
  • Take a final walkthrough of your old home

After Moving (1-2 Weeks)

  • Firstly, unpack the essentials
  • Set up the utility and the internet
  • Check for damage and report if necessary
  • Explore and settle into your home
